E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
PoCo
Poco
::ThreadPool
Poco
::ThreadPool提供线程池功能,减少线程的创建和销毁所带来的开销,适合在服务器上应用。创建线程池时指定最少运行线程数和线程池的最大容量,若不指定则采用默认值,取2和16。
lilai
·
2012-08-18 13:00
library
Poco
::ThreadPool
阅读更多
Poco
::ThreadPool提供线程池功能,减少线程的创建和销毁所带来的开销,适合在服务器上应用。创建线程池时指定最少运行线程数和线程池的最大容量,若不指定则采用默认值,取2和16。
lilai
·
2012-08-18 13:00
Library
Poco
::ThreadPool
Poco
::ThreadPool提供线程池功能,减少线程的创建和销毁所带来的开销,适合在服务器上应用。创建线程池时指定最少运行线程数和线程池的最大容量,若不指定则采用默认值,取2和16。
fym0121
·
2012-08-18 11:00
服务器
活动
Poco
::Thread
Poco
实现线程的机制,它将线程Thread和线程运行的实体Runnable分离开来,就像一个框架,Thread管理线程优先级,堆栈,维护线程局部变量;而运行的代码是在Runnable的子类run方法中实现的
fym0121
·
2012-08-17 17:00
JOIN
thread
框架
Class
匿名namespace
Poco
中,我发现有好多匿名namespace的使用,定义一个类,然后,在定义类的文件中namespace { classAa; }再给类添加一个default方法,得到对这个a的引用。
fym0121
·
2012-08-15 17:00
Poco
::ThreadLocal
模版ThreadLocal用于定义局部与线程的变量,两个线程可以同时引用同一个ThreadLocal,但他们实际操作的内存是不一样的,这也是它的实现机制。我这里只写出实现机制,而不写出方法,方法的话,开代码更明了。这里有两个线程对象Thread_1和Thread_2,在每个线程中有一个map的容器,我们忽略TLSAbstractSlot*,其实它是对其他数据类型的封装,暂时,只认为它是指向某个内存
fym0121
·
2012-08-15 17:00
thread
存储
Poco
中的RunnableAdaptor实现浅析
Poco
是一个设计相当好的C++框架库。RunnableAdaptor,继承自Runnable,提供了注册和执行类成员函数的接口。
zero_lee
·
2012-08-15 10:00
thread
function
object
callback
interface
methods
Poco
中的task与notification的关系
Poco
中,Task与Notification之间的关系图如下:TaskManager维护着一个NotificationCenter,客户端代码向TaskManager添加不同类型的Task,故而TaskManager
zero_lee
·
2012-08-15 10:00
thread
list
Poco
::Logger
这篇文章描述
Poco
中的日志框架。
Poco
的日志系统有三个类组成,
Poco
::Channel,
Poco
::Formater还有
Poco
::Message。
fym0121
·
2012-08-14 15:00
Poco
::Path &
Poco
::File
背景知识:在unix和windows上,路径的表示方法是不一样的。windows上:Node:\Device\Paths,linux上:/Paths。路径中的分割符不一样,一个反斜杠,另一个是正斜杠。两个路径之间的分割符也不一样。windows上是分号,linux上是冒号。例如,windows上,环境变量Path的典型值是C:\ProgramFiles\CommonFiles\NetSarang;
fym0121
·
2012-08-13 15:00
windows
linux
unix
File
System
Path
Poco
::Notification
通知,提供了同步或异步执行通知消息的功能,处理生产者消费者模型,在多线程中有用武之地。通知(Notification)和事件(BasicEvent)的区别,我认为是,通知中,Observer会主动查看是否有通知消息,如果没有,会一直阻塞或者阻塞一段时间。Observer在NotificationCenter中会被简单地被回调。事件(BasicEvent)中的代理不会主动查看是否有事件发生,只有事件
fym0121
·
2012-08-10 17:00
Poco
::DataTime
DataTime就是日期和时间,这两个东西的区别在于表示方法。日期往往要格式化为字符串,时间一般用长整形表示。时间可以精确到微妙,即秒的百万分之一。我见这个模块中,有一个表达是可以由微妙得到百纳秒的精度,但是没看懂inlineTimestamp::UtcTimeValTimestamp::utcTime()const { return_ts*10+(TimeDiff(0x01b21dd2)<<32
fym0121
·
2012-08-09 20:00
Poco
::BasicEvent
Poco
的Event模块都是在.h文件中实现的,全部是用模版实现的。它的作用是当某个事件发生时,一些回调函数可以被执行。
fym0121
·
2012-08-09 20:00
POCO
中数据库的操作
POCO
关于数据库封装操作放在Data目录下,以前用过关于SQLite的封装库感觉挻不错的,这次要写个C\S的软件数据库采用的是SQLServer,于是就再次选用了
Poco
。
·
2012-08-08 15:00
sql
数据库
server
session
sqlite
table
database
Poco
::StringTokenizer & String
//Library:Foundation//Package:Core//Module: StringTokenizer功能:String.h文件中声明了几个静态函数,用于去除string的开头和结尾的空白字符,大小写转换,字符串比较,字符映射,字符串替换,字符串连接。StringTokenizer用于从一个字符串中解析出单词(如果以空白字符作分割符)。方法:templateStrimLeft(co
fym0121
·
2012-08-08 09:00
Poco
::MemoryPool
//Library:Foundation//Package:Core//Module: MemoryPool功能:提供一个内存池,以减少new和delete的调用,提高效率,这往往是为服务端提供的。public方法void*get();voidrelease(void*ptr);intallocated()const;intavailable()const;get方法返回内存池中的一个内存块的地址
fym0121
·
2012-08-07 21:00
Poco
::format &
Poco
::NumberFormatter &
Poco
::NumberParser
Poco
::format是一个全局静态函数,提供了类似与std::printf函数的功能,但这个函数最多只能接受6个参数。
fym0121
·
2012-08-07 20:00
Poco
::ByteOrder
//Library:Foundation//Package:Core//Module: ByteOrder//Namespace:
Poco
功能:这个类包含了几个静态的方法,用于将整数在大小端,主机网络字节序间转换
fym0121
·
2012-08-07 17:00
Poco
::Bugcheck
//Library:Foundation//Package:Core//Module: Bugcheck//Namespace:
Poco
功能:Bugcheck提供了几个有用的宏,可以实现参数检测,逻辑错误检测
fym0121
·
2012-08-07 17:00
Poco
::Ascii
//Library:Foundation//Package:Core//Module: Ascii功能:处理Ascii字符,对是否为控制字符,空白字符,字母,数字,标调符号,大小写等作出判断。这个类的实现是通过一个静态数组实现的,下表是Ascii值,数组里放着这个元素的属性。Public方法staticboolisAscii(intch);/*是否为Ascii,即[0...127]*/ stati
fym0121
·
2012-08-07 15:00
Poco
::NestedDiagnosticContext
//Library:Foundation//Package:Core//Module: NestedDiagnosticContext//Namespace:
Poco
//功能:对函数调用栈进行跟踪,调试时
fym0121
·
2012-08-07 15:00
CppUnit类结构UML图
这个CppUnit包是
POCO
中的CppUnit的简化版本,但是开展测试C++的测试用例来说已经足够了。
fym0121
·
2012-08-06 10:00
OpenRTMFP/Cumulus Primer(22)线程逻辑分析之一:RTMFPServer线程的启动和等待
线程的启动和等待作者:柳大·Poechant(钟超Michael)博客:Blog.csdn.net/poechant邮箱:
[email protected]
日期:August5th,20121
Poco
Poechant
·
2012-08-05 00:00
OpenRTMFP/Cumulus Primer(22)线程逻辑分析之一:RTMFPServer线程的启动和等待
Poechant(钟超 Michael) 博客:Blog.csdn.net/poechant 邮箱:
[email protected]
日期:August 5th, 2012 1
Poco
Poechant
·
2012-08-05 00:00
OpenRTMFP/Cumulus Primer(22)线程逻辑分析之一:RTMFPServer线程的启动和等待
线程的启动和等待作者:柳大·Poechant(钟超Michael)博客:Blog.csdn.net/poechant邮箱:
[email protected]
日期:August5th,20121
Poco
Poechant
·
2012-08-05 00:00
centos6.2更新yum源
更新yum源博客分类: Linux #备份#mv/etc/yum.repos.d/CentOS-Base.repo{,.bak}#修改#vi/etc/yum.repos.d/CentOS-Base.re
poCo
nfig
fanyshow
·
2012-08-03 16:38
centos6.2更新yum源
POCO
ImanewbieforopenFrameworks,ihaveanewprojectandeffectlyihaveanewproblem...2>LINK:fatalerrorLNK1104:nosepuedeabrirelarchivo'
Poco
Foundationd.lib'Ihavetriedfollowtheexamplesforsetupthesolutio
leowangzi
·
2012-07-30 14:00
properties
express
ide
textbox
2010
preprocessor
POCO
的 Zip 类对中文文件名支持不正确的解决方法
POCO
在Windows中默认是定义了
POCO
_WIN32_UTF8#ifdefined(
POCO
_WIN32_UTF8) std::wstringutf16Path; UnicodeConverter
kowity
·
2012-07-26 10:00
windows
String
File
null
Access
Path
HTML5 网站大观:15个精美的 HTML5 作品集网站实例
Poco
PeopleDesiignJibe
山边小溪
·
2012-07-24 20:26
html5
网页设计
使用
POCO
库测试代码执行效率
使用传统的 C中的测试时间方法较为费事,第三方
POCO
开源库中有相应的类可解决此问题。首先需要安装
POCO
库,具体过程省略。
·
2012-07-19 09:00
测试
HTML5 网站大观:15个精美的 HTML5 作品集网站实例
Poco
PeopleDesiignJibe
梦想天空(山边小溪)
·
2012-07-19 00:00
html5
网站
大观
HTML5 网站大观:15个精美的 HTML5 作品集网站实例
Poco
PeopleDesiignJibe
梦想天空(山边小溪)
·
2012-07-19 00:00
html5
网站
大观
MVC3 项目总结
11/2587002.html最常见的验证方式是:在实体的属性上加 特性(Attribute) 的方式来完成基本的数据验证.比如Required,StringLength,Range等.为了保持实体类的
POCO
·
2012-07-12 09:00
mvc
flask自定义路由/route,正则表达式
详情参见http://werkzeug.
poco
o.org/docs/routing/#custom-converters例fromflaskimportFlask fromwerkzeug.routingimportBaseConverter
lanybass
·
2012-07-03 09:00
正则
flask
route
路由
POCO
::Foundation 内存管理(一) AutoPtr
引用计数:1.无论何时一个引用被销毁或重写,它所引用的对象的引用计数减少。2.无论何时一个引用被创建或拷贝,它所引用的对象的引用计数增加。3.初始时的引用计数是1。4.当一个对象的引用计数为0时,这个对象资源被销毁。5.在多线程环境下,增加和减少操作必须是原子的操作。对象拥有权:1.如果某人拥有一个对象的拥有权,那么他有责任在对象不需要的时候删除这个对象。2.如果对象的拥有者销毁资源失败,那么就会
ma52103231
·
2012-07-02 11:00
thread
多线程
c
vector
delete
Class
WindowsXP完善搭建
POCO
开发环境
问题描述:编译好了
POCO
库,配置了一些基本的设置之后(其实没几个),试图在VS2005创建一个样例程序,先跑跑看。
ma52103231
·
2012-06-29 09:00
c
dll
qt
Path
include
Entity Framework系列文章导航
EntityFramework4中删除所有数据行的几种方法EntityFramework4-多对多、自关联的关系EntityFramework4-从模型创建数据库EntityFramework4第二篇
POCO
2EntityFramework4
lyq5655779
·
2012-06-27 15:00
oracle
数据库
存储
LINQ
2010
centos6.2更新yum源
#备份#mv/etc/yum.repos.d/CentOS-Base.repo{,.bak}#修改#vi/etc/yum.repos.d/CentOS-Base.re
poCo
nfig代码 # CentOS-Base.repo
Romen
·
2012-06-27 10:00
OpenRTMFP/Cumulus Primer(20)Cumulus的一个线程启动 Bug
zhongchao.ustc#gmail.com(#->@)博客:Blog.CSDN.net/Poechant日期:June25th,2012Cumulus中的线程都是继承自Startable,在其中封装
Poco
Poechant
·
2012-06-25 10:00
thread
exception
UP
Poco
::TCPServer框架解析
POCO
C++Libraries提供一套C++的类库用以开发基于网络的可移植的应用程序,功能涉及线程、文件、流,网络协议包括:HTTP、FTP、SMTP等,还提供XML的解析和SQL数据库的访问接口。
adermxl
·
2012-06-21 15:00
Introduction A Guided Tour of the
POCO
OCOC++库是开源的用于简化和加速C++开发面向网络、可移植应用程序的C++库集,
POCO
库和C++标准库可以很好的集成并填补了C++标准库缺乏的功能空隙。
jay329106193
·
2012-06-20 19:00
EF
POCO
(自定义实体类) 创建过程
1建表CREATETABLE[dbo].[TEST]( [v1][int]IDENTITY(1,1)NOTNULL, [v2][varbinary](50)NOTNULL, [v3][datetime]NOTNULL, CONSTRAINT[PK_TEST]PRIMARYKEYCLUSTERED ( [v1]ASC )WITH(PAD_INDEX=OFF,STATISTICS_NORECO
newegg2009
·
2012-06-07 10:00
String
null
Class
sqlserver
statistics
5_28_天天向上
yidao620c.iteye.com/blog/1395553#备份#mv/etc/yum.repos.d/CentOS-Base.repo{,.bak}#修改#vi/etc/yum.repos.d/CentOS-Base.re
poCo
nfig
doublewei1
·
2012-06-05 19:25
POCO
::Net 简单的HTTP客户端,服务器程序
今天让我们来开始一个简单的HTTP程序,分为客户端和服务器。先来完成一个客户端程序。所要关心的类有HTTPSClientSession//HTTP会话类 HTTPRequest//HTTP请求类 HTTPResponse//HTTP回应类首先当然是建立一个会话,在此基础上发送一个请求,最后收到一个回应。HTTPClientSessions("127.0.0.1",9090);//指定目标的IP地址
ma52103231
·
2012-06-04 18:00
多线程
String
服务器
application
Class
buffer
如何读懂一本书 章图
如何快速读懂一本书呢,下面看看我们是怎么做的吧外链地址:http://img13.
poco
.cn/my
poco
/myphoto/20120602/21/6467324820120602214556013
han_yankun2009
·
2012-06-02 21:00
如何读懂一本书 章图
如何快速读懂一本书呢,下面看看我们是怎么做的吧外链地址:http://img13.
poco
.cn/my
poco
/myphoto/20120602/21/6467324820120602214556013
wsql
·
2012-06-02 21:00
书
使用
POCO
中的 XMLConfiguration 管理配置文件
usingnamespace
Poco
::Util; usingnamespace
Poco
; //1.创建空的配置 AutoPtrcfg(newXMLConfiguration()); //2.设置根的名称
kowity
·
2012-05-31 08:00
xml
String
测试
mfc
2010
使用
POCO
的方法来拆分字符串(支持中文)
#include"
Poco
/StringTokenizer.h" #include using
Poco
::StringTokenizer; intmain(intargc,char**argv)
kowity
·
2012-05-29 23:00
POCO
::XML(一) 简单写XML文档
在项目中需要用到
POCO
这个C++库,它的资源太少了,很多是英文,幸亏英文文档不是太难,语法还算能让人保持兴趣。
POCO
库中有很多模块,今天和大家聊聊XML这个子模块。
ma52103231
·
2012-05-28 17:00
ios
c
xml
网络
文档
encoding
Ubuntu下OpenRTMFP安装
环境 Ubunut 11 安装相关的库 lua5.1
poco
openssl gcc apt-get install openssl libssl-dev libiodbc2
bwhzhl
·
2012-05-24 11:00
ubuntu
上一页
29
30
31
32
33
34
35
36
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他